Огромный сборник статей от WPTec для начинающих

Мнение

В Gutenberg 7.4 добавлены новые элементы управления цветом, интерфейс ссылок и блоки для разработчиков

Вчера команда разработчиков Gutenberg выпустила версию 7.4 плагина . Обновление включает в себя несколько функций, ориентированных на пользователя: элемент управления цветом текста для блока группы, элемент управления цветом фона для блока столбцов и новый интерфейс ссылок для компонентов с форматированным текстом. Для разработчиков команда представила скрипт для запуска плагина блока из командной строки.

После резкого увеличения скорости в последнем обновлении версия 7.4 продолжает двигаться по тому же пути. При тестировании с сообщением, содержащим примерно 36 000 слов и 1000 блоков, скорость загрузки страницы упала с 5,461 до 5,037 с, а количество нажатий клавиш – с 34,63 до 34,54 мс. Это незначительное снижение, но помогает каждое улучшение.

Обновление включает более двух десятков исправлений ошибок и несколько улучшений. Работа в направлении навигационного блока продолжается. Опыт постепенно улучшается, но он все еще не готов к производству.

Команда также запустила ранний экспериментальный механизм для обработки глобальных стилей , функция, которая может быть завершена в этом году. Глобальные стили позволят темам устанавливать цвета по умолчанию, типографские настройки и, возможно, многое другое. Авторы тем должны следить за развитием этой функции и предлагать отзывы.

Групповой блок получает управление цветом текста

Команда Гутенберга снова снимает одну из моих самых больших проблем. При использовании группового блока в прошлом конечные пользователи не могли применить цвет текста к каждому подэлементу группового блока. Вместо этого им пришлось добавить цвет текста к любым блокам в группе. Временами это был кропотливый процесс, особенно с группами из многих блоков.

С этим изменением в версии 7.4 пользователи могут применять цвет текста ко всей группе сразу, и этот цвет должен переходить в субблоки. Конечно, при необходимости пользователи могут изменить цвет внутренних блоков.

Блок столбцов получает управление цветом фона

Gutenberg 7.4 добавляет элемент управления цветом фона в блок столбцов . Это заставляет его работать аналогично групповому блоку, добавляя цвет фона ко всему содержащему блоку. К сожалению, в этом выпуске не было такого же элемента управления цветом текста.

В настоящее время по-прежнему нет возможности добавить цвет фона и текста в отдельный столбец. Конечные пользователи могут добавлять цвет только к субблокам в столбце. Эта функция – шаг в правильном направлении, но по-прежнему отсутствуют некоторые важные цветовые параметры.

Интерфейс ссылки обновлен

Это незначительное изменение, но приветствуем. Пользовательский интерфейс ссылки для форматированного текста, компонент, используемый для блоков, таких как абзацы, теперь имеет тот же пользовательский интерфейс, что и блоки навигации и кнопок. Последовательность хорошая, но я фанат улучшения в целом.

Изменения пользовательского интерфейса незначительны, но они кажутся более удобными после дня использования.

Блочные леса для разработчиков

Для разработчиков, которые хотят запустить новый плагин блока, команда Гутенберга выпустила официальный скрипт для начала работы. Запустив npm init @wordpress/blockкоманду, сценарий установит и проведет вас через настройку пользовательского блока. Скрипт создает целую папку плагина, включая необходимые файлы PHP, CSS и JavaScript.

Этот скрипт идеально подходит для создания моноблочных плагинов, которые в конечном итоге будут доступны через официальный каталог блоков WordPress. Поскольку он создает целый плагин, это, вероятно, не лучший способ создания новых блоков в существующем плагине.

 

Рекомендуем прочитать
Мнение

Плагин Delete Me для WordPress помогает владельцам веб-сайтов предоставить право на забвение GDPR

Мнение

Команда Gutenberg наращивает юзабилити-тестирование в WordCamp US

Мнение

Плагин распространителя теперь в бета-версии: новое решение для синдикации контента WordPress от 10up

Мнение

Gutenberg 1.8 добавляет большую расширяемость для разработчиков плагинов

Подпишитесь на рассылку
и будьте в курсе новостей Wordpress

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*